Despite the efforts of New Jersey’s Republican Governor, Chris Christie, to block same sex marriages, that state’s Supreme Court ruled against the administration. The ruling means that NJ can start recognizing and performing same sex marriages today.
I’d like to welcome New Jersey to the 21st Century and congratulate the efforts of Garden State Equality and others who worked to make this possible. New Jersey becomes the 14th state (plus Washington D.C.) to legalize same sex marriage. It also means that the entire Northeast region of the United States now recognize gay marriage.
